Although Sergio the penguin loves to play soccer, he is very clumsy and uncoordinated and he practices day and night, hoping he can help his team win the big game against the Seagulls.

Little soccer players will enjoy submitted by ejmarcash on August 13, 2012, 9:21pm My preschool son, who loves to play soccer, really enjoyed this book. He listened carefully as I read about Sergio's ups and downs while playing soccer. Here's hoping all kids listen and practice the message of not giving up to achieve success.
